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. The length of time does it require to install a back door?
The installation time varies depending upon the kind of door and the intricacy of the job, however typically, a professional installer can complete the job in a few hours.
2. What kind of door is best for a back entry?
Fiberglass doors are popular for back entries due to their resilience and energy performance. Nevertheless, wood doors can provide aesthetic appeal, while steel doors offer enhanced security.
3. Can I set up a back door myself?
While it is possible, employing a professional is advisable for ideal outcomes. DIY setups might result in errors, impacting the door's performance and longevity.
4. What should I search for in a quote?
A comprehensive quote should consist of the cost of the door, labor, clean-up, and any extra products required for installation. Avoid quotes that seem abnormally low, as they may stint quality.
5. How can I take care of my new back door?
Routine maintenance, such as cleansing and inspecting weather condition removing, can extend the life of your door. Consider using a sealant or paint to protect it from the components if it's made from wood.
